Войти

Показать полную графическую версию : BS Post Installer - выбор программ перед установкой


Страниц : 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 [102] 103 104 105 106 107 108 109

NikLok
26-12-2013, 12:13
timon45, В личку не получилось - лимит.
Так что http://rghost.ru/51215388

Boa Soft
04-02-2014, 01:43
Текущая версия 1.19.4.3

Новое в текущей версии.

1. Наведен порядок с версиями всех компонентов программы.
2. Исправлено пропадание полосы прокрутки в окне выбора пресетов.
3. Исправлены лишние циклы перерисовки окна выбора пресетов.
4. Исправлено бага невозможности выбора последнего пресета по умолчанию.
5. Выбранный по умолчанию пресет всегда отображается в окне без необходимости прокрутки.
6. Добавлена ссылка на форум в окне О программе.
7. Добавлена информация о необходимом числе перезагрузок в лог выбранных программ.
8. Наконец обнаружена и, возможно, исправлена бага с не перезагрузкой в XP.

Огромная просьба к желающим проверить пункт №8

Хвост проблемы сидел в том, что под отладчиком великолепно получается привилегия на завершение/перезагрузку, а без - нет.

Программа во вложении в шапке.

Nordek
04-02-2014, 14:12
Boa Soft, Пара моментов:
1 - В Windows 7 при закрытии программы выдаёт сообщение "Помощник по совместимости программ":
http://imagizer.imageshack.us/v2/150x100q90/541/z7q5.png (http://imageshack.com/a/img541/4918/z7q5.png)
я конечно понимаю что для XP и всё такое - но всё таки, не хотелось бы наблюдать такое на Windows 7.

2 - Задержка всплывающего сообщения:
http://imagizer.imageshack.us/v2/150x100q90/827/xwpu.png (http://imageshack.com/a/img827/2715/xwpu.png)
я так понял не успевает следить за движением курсора и обрабатывать вызов всплывающего сообщения при переходах с одного варианта на другой .

Boa Soft
04-02-2014, 22:41
я конечно понимаю что для XP и всё такое - но всё таки, не хотелось бы наблюдать такое на Windows 7. »

Такое поведение вызывается если в имени программы есть setup или install + еще что-то, что я пока точно не знаю.
Возможно, код возврата, отличный от 0. Это буду проверять.

Но, хитрая винда еще смотрит и в ресурсы. И если в информации о версии так же встречается setup или install, то тоже происходит такой же финт!!! Переименовал pre.exe и убил все упоминания setup или instalд из VersionInfo и чудо - этот диалог более не появляется.

Вобщем, винда считает мою программу инсталлятором (чем по сути она и является).

Этих вещей я до сегодняшнего дня не знал. Вы первый, кто обратил внимание на данное поведение. Буду выяснять причину.

я так понял не успевает следить за движением курсора и обрабатывать вызов всплывающего сообщения при переходах с одного варианта на другой . »

Там нет индивидуальной подсказки для разных пунктов.

Нашел-таки как блокировать ненавистный диалог, не меняя имя и версию. Записью в реестре.
Хоть по читерски, но работает. В следующей версии добавлю.

timon45
11-02-2014, 01:31
Где можно прочесть расшифровку следующих параметров (а то уже запарился эксперементировать)
TestModeLabelFont=Tahoma,1,12,clRed,clNone,clWhite,1,clWhite,clNone
StageLabelFont=Tahoma,1,12,clWhite,clNone,clWhite,1,$000080ff,clNone
LeftLabelFont=Tahoma,1,12,clWhite,clNone,clWhite,1,$000080ff,clNone
LeftButtonFont=Tahoma,0,12,$225500,clNone,clWhite,1,$00A00000,clNone
TimerLabelFont=Tahoma,1,20,clWhite,clNone,clWhite,1,$000080ff,clNone
MemoLabel1Font=Tahoma,1,13,clWhite,clNone,clWhite,1,$000080ff,clNone
MemoLabel2Font=Tahoma,1,18,clWhite,clNone,clWhite,1,$000080ff,clNone

LabelFont=Tahoma,0,12,$996699,clNone,clGray,1,$000080ff,clNone
SmallLabelFont=Tahoma,0,10,$996699,clNone,clGray,1,$000080ff,clNone
ButtonFont=Tahoma,0,12,$225500,clNone,clGray,1,$00A00000,clNone
UrlLabelFont=Tahoma,1,8,clWhite,clNone,clGray,1,clWhite,clNone
BigLabelFont=Arial,1,18,clWhite,clNone,clGray,1,clWhite,clNone
ReadMeMemoFont=Tahoma,0,12,clWhite,clNone,clGray,1,clWhite,clNone
LicenseMemoFont=Tahoma,0,12,clWhite,clNone,clGray,1,clWhite,clNone
SelectProgMemoFont=Tahoma,0,12,clWhite,clNone,clGray,1,clWhite,clNone
FinishLogMemoFont=Tahoma,0,12,clWhite,clNone,clGray,1,clWhite,clNone
CheckListInfoFont=Tahoma,0,12,clBlack,clNone,clNone,0,$996699,clNone
CheckListCaptionFont=Tahoma,1,13,$996699,clNone,clNone,0,$000080ff,clNone
TreeItemFont=Tahoma,0,12,clWhite,clNone,clGray,2,clWhite,clMenuHighlight
TreeGroupFont=Tahoma,1,12,$0066DD,clNone,clGray,2,clWhite,$0066DD
HintFont=Tahoma,0,8,clBlue,clInfoBk,clNone,0,clBlack,clSkyBlue,
CommonFont=Tahoma,0,8,$996699,clNone,clGray,0,clWhite,clNone
TestTrialModeLabelFont=Tahoma,1,12,clRed,clNone,clGray,1,clWhite,clNone
П.С. Очень рад что Boa Soft вернулся к продвижению данного проекта, я бы и рад протестировать но функционал который я использую программа отрабатывает. Могу лишь предложить следующее: 1 добавить win8/8.1 в условия установки программ (конфигуратора) 2 Не плохо бы видеть скриншот программы не только во время её установки но и на этапе выбора (к примеру под описанием) когда навести курсор на программу (или возможность включения и отключения данной опции).

mig73
13-02-2014, 04:43
Boa Soft, Большое спасибо за продолжение. Наконец то бага с не перезагрузкой в XP больше не появляется, чему не сказано рад !

NikLok
13-02-2014, 11:17
Boa Soft, А что так возрос объём исполняемой части (ехе). Что компилятор сменился или отладочная инфа присутствует?

mig73
16-02-2014, 07:59
Подскажите пожалуйста в какой все-таки кодировке должен быть файл описания, указываемый в ключе NfoFileName из PRESETUP.INI ?

Survover
16-02-2014, 15:03
Привет ! У меня есть старая версия программы если я перенесу с нее PRESETUP.INI на новую версию все будет работать ?

boss911
16-02-2014, 15:51
mig73

Unicode (1200, UTF-16 LE).

[hr]
Survover

Будет. Только в вашем PRESETUP.INI должно быть:
[Common_Info]
Ver=2.1
А вот SKIN.INI лучше обновите. Дополнительно можно воспользоваться конфигуратором, пересохранить в нем свой старый PRESETUP.INI

Survover
17-02-2014, 20:08
я уже сделал ) Вот только когда нажимаю отметить все программы то одну не отмечает почему то 40 прог а отмечает 39 а net framework нет

а и где скины можно с скачать ?

Fortress1
18-02-2014, 08:58
я уже сделал ) Вот только когда нажимаю отметить все программы то одну не отмечает почему то 40 прог а отмечает 39 а net framework нет

а и где скины можно с скачать ?

нигде)))
посмотри может исключает какая то программа установку твоего frame. Exclude параметр.

Boa Soft
28-02-2014, 00:01
Обновление до версии 1.19.5.1

Новое в текущей версии.

1. Добавлен новый префикс #WAIT:XX - ожидание XX секунд.
2. Добавлены префиксы #KILL:<EXENAME> и #KILLALL:<EXENAME> - уничтожить процесс/все экземпляры <EXENAME>
3. Добавлена проверка на целостность скина - отсутствующие строки локализации выводятся в диалог ошибки и в лог.
4. Добавлена проверка наличия всех файлов программы.
5. Добавлен контроль имени файла программы.
6. Программа переименована в BSPost и исправлен ресурс версии для обеспечения лучшей совместимости с win 7
(появлялся иногда диалог "эта программа возможно установлена неправильно").
7. Имя по умолчанию файла конфигурации изменено на BSPost.ini
8. Исправлен ряд ошибок в строках локализации.


Скачивать из шапки.

По поводу скинов - постараюсь собрать все достойные из старого и перегнать в новый формат.

Survover
01-03-2014, 12:14
За ранее спасибо за скины )

NikLok
03-03-2014, 11:15
Boa Soft, Ранее предлагал ввести такую конструкцию:

CheckTagFile=EXCEED_v9.exe
Command1=%CheckTagFile%


Это позволит редактировать имя файла в одном месте а не в двух или более как сейчас.

Ну и еще конечно хотелось бы использовать метаимена.

Например вместо EXCEED_v9.exe писать EXCEED_*.exe

Это также позволить при смене версии не править ini файл.

nibble74
03-03-2014, 18:00
Boa Soft,

Есть ли новый SkinEdit.exe ???

С новой версией 1.19.5.1 не работает тестирование скина.

Boa Soft
05-03-2014, 02:46
Есть ли новый SkinEdit.exe ???
С новой версией 1.19.5.1 не работает тестирование скина. »

Нет и не будет. Все перенесено в сам bsPost

BsPost.exe /skinedit

NikLok
05-03-2014, 11:04
Нет и не будет. Все перенесено в сам bsPost »И то о чем я так мечтал "нечаянно" сбылось! ):

XXXler
06-03-2014, 13:50
Boa Soft, при запуске с флешки, которая в режиме ReadOnly по прежнему сыпется куча сообщений "Запись на диск невозможна. Бла-бла-бла". Предположительно проблема в процедуре загрузки иконки из файла в контрол. Можно ли надеяться на исправление данного глюка?

Boa Soft
06-03-2014, 21:26
Boa Soft, при запуске с флешки, которая в режиме ReadOnly по прежнему сыпется куча сообщений "Запись на диск невозможна. Бла-бла-бла". Предположительно проблема в процедуре загрузки иконки из файла в контрол. Можно ли надеяться на исправление данного глюка? »

Проверил на Zalman ZME-200 в режиме read-only - ни одной ошибки.

Для работы ОБЯЗАТЕЛЬНО должно быть доступно для записи:

1. Временная папка TempDir=
2. LogFile=




© OSzone.net 2001-2012